Rhino USA Retractable Straps – Freshwater Compatible
Rhino USA brings a family-owned touch to boat tie downs with their retractable trailer straps. Designed for freshwater use, these straps feature powder-coated black steel hardware that resists corrosion in typical lake or river conditions. With a 600 lb working load limit and 1,800 lb max break strength, they’re well-suited for jet skis, small fishing boats, and lightweight runabouts.
The auto-retract function is activated by a push-button release, winding the 2×43-inch strap back into the housing for tangle-free storage. Installation requires bolting to square tube or channel iron trailer frames using the included 3/8-inch hardware—if your trailer lacks pre-drilled holes, a simple drill bit is all you need. These straps are a solid, affordable option for freshwater enthusiasts who value simplicity and American support.

Buyer’s Guide: What to Consider
Choosing the right retractable boat tie downs depends on your boat size, trailer type, and water conditions. Here are five key factors to consider.
- Break Strength: Look for straps with a break strength that exceeds your boat's weight. A 2500 lbs rating offers a good safety margin for most boats.
- Corrosion Resistance: If you trailer in saltwater, choose stainless steel or powder-coated hardware. Standard steel will rust quickly in marine environments.
- Strap Length: Most retractable straps are 43 inches long. Ensure this length is sufficient to reach your boat's transom tie-down points without excessive slack.
- Mounting Type: Bolt-on installation is common. Check that your trailer frame has pre-drilled holes or that you can drill 3/8-inch holes for mounting.
- Retract Mechanism: Push-button release or automatic winding makes storage easy. Look for a smooth retract action to prevent tangles and flapping on the road.
